NetBIOS isn't really an Internet protocol. It needs to run on top of a transport protocol to traverse the network, so at best it's a session protocol. I don't see any practical use in comparing anything but IPv4 to IPv6. Ancient history and niche protocols that you'll likely never use are of no use to you.
